Abstract
  • Sequential screening has become increasingly popular in drug discovery. It iteratively builds quantitativestructure−activity relationship (QSAR) models from successive high-throughput screens, making screeningmore effective and efficient. We compare cluster structure−activity relationship analysis (CSARA) as aQSAR method with recursive partitioning (RP), by designing three strategies for sequential collection andanalysis of screening data. Various descriptor sets are used in the QSAR models to characterize chemicalstructure, including high-dimensional sets and some that by design have many variables not related to activity.The results show that CSARA outperforms RP. We also extend the CSARA method to deal with a continuousassay measurement.
